Abstract

A control device for a compression-ignition engine in which partial compression-ignition combustion including spark ignition (SI) combustion performed by combusting a portion of a mixture gas inside a cylinder by spark-ignition followed by compression ignition (CI) combustion performed by causing the remaining mixture gas to self-ignite is executed at least within a part of an engine operating range is provided, which includes a detector configured to detect a given parameter that changes as combustion progresses inside the cylinder, an A/F (air-fuel ratio) controller configured to change an air-fuel ratio of air to fuel introduced into the cylinder, and a combustion controller configured to determine combustion stability based on the detected parameter of the detector and control the A/F controller to reduce the air-fuel ratio when it is confirmed that during the partial compression-ignition combustion the combustion stability is low.
